This photo shows the pupils at Hiwassee School in Smith County, Tennessee. I'm not sure about the origins of the term, but you would assume it was Native American. The photograph was taken in 1902. It looks like a small one-room school, as many others at the time. Notice the rough-hewn construction. The boys all wear knee pants or overalls. The overalls look a little different than proper storebought overalls. Boys mostly wore suspenders. We cannot see the three older girls in the back row, but all the others pupils are barefoot. Also the boy in the front row, wearing his best clothing with a large white ruffled collar, is in bare feet.
